Transaction d2107b9b68542a1354216bc95edd0148409e78df1aa8762a9ae16d4f12f3af7f

116 Input
2 Outputs
  • d2107b9b68542a1354216bc95edd0148409e78df1aa8762a9ae16d4f12f3af7f:0
  • value  510892
    address  31qcarDwSTtcA9CxzeHfXzVUkfUFWPXcBa
  • d2107b9b68542a1354216bc95edd0148409e78df1aa8762a9ae16d4f12f3af7f:1
  • value  2138266947
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s